Paul de Man is often associated with an era of high theory; an era it is argued may now be coming to a close. This book, written by three leading contemporary scholars, includes a previously unpublished text by de Man of his handwritten notes for a lecture on Walter Benjamin. Challenging and relevant, this volume presents de Man s work as a critical resource for dealing with the most important questions of the twenty-first century and argues for the place of theory within it."
